About The Position

The Advanced Electronic Warfare (EW) product line within the Advanced Technology Strategic Business Unit is seeking an experienced Program Manager to lead and provide direct oversight of cost, schedule, and technical performance for an emerging technology portfolio valued at $20M+ per year in programs and IRAD. These programs represent significant growth within the Advanced EW portfolio with potential of $150M+ over the next 5 years and technology transfer into production mission areas. This role is onsite located in Goleta, California.
